Microsoft Forms

Microsoft Forms is a web-based tool that allows users to create surveys, quizzes, polls, and other types of forms quickly and easily. It is a part of the Microsoft 365 suite of applications and can be accessed via a web browser or the Microsoft Forms app on mobile devices.

With Microsoft Forms, users can create custom surveys or quizzes for a variety of purposes such as gathering feedback, conducting market research, collecting customer data, and even creating educational assessments. Users can also choose from a wide range of pre-built templates to create forms quickly, or they can start from scratch and design a custom form that meets their specific needs.
